The Ruins DVD review
Based on the best-selling novel by Scott Smith The Ruins, released on October 13, 2008 follows a group of friends who become entangled in a brutal struggle for survival after visiting a remote archaeological dig in the Mexican jungle.
Suprise, suprise, there be evil in 'dem jungles. Jonathan Tucker (The Black Donnellys), Jena Malone (Pride and Prejudice), Shawn Ashmore (X-Men: The Last Stand), Laura Ramsey (She's the Man) and Joe Anderson (Across the Universe), become trapped on the site by 'local' inhabitants who will not allow the group to leave... at any cost! As in many of the 'horror-flicks' released in recent years, little is left to the imagination, and it's a little like The Happening - it's a good premise, but alas it really doesn't quite live up to the hype. However, it definitely passes a few hours and is a good group watch, especially in halls of residence! Alas, it's not a movie to buy your mother, but it's a good one for your best mate, on a budget... we give it 6/10.
